Updating your TCL TV via USB is a reliable way to get the latest features, security patches, and performance fixes when a standard over-the-air (OTA) update isn't working or your TV isn't connected to the internet.   1. Look at the white sticker on the back of the TV.
  2. Look for a code that usually starts with the year. Examples: V8-RT, V8-T, or MS68.
  3. Alternatively, navigate to: Settings > System > About > Device Name / Build.
